  • Coordinate wardrobe & palette
    Earth tones, pastels, or jewel tones? Match outfits to the backdrop. Soft florals pair with garden settings, neutrals stand out in oak canopies, bold colors pop against cacti.

  • Time it right
    Shade versus open sun matters. Midday sun can be harsh in open areas—opt for shade under oaks or plan around the "golden hour" by the lake or redwoods.

  • Plan for logistics
    Parking, permits, pets, props…check ahead. Black Miners Bar and other state parks require a $12 parking fee, and some private properties don’t allow pets.

  • Choose convenience or rustic locations according to your group

    If you have members in your group who have trouble walking, have little ones who may need to be close to your vehicle for emergencies, or you plan on wearing heels, make sure to ask about convenient locations with a short walking distance.

    Family portraits come down to a preference in the look and setting. The studio offers climate control, the ability to keep your hair/makeup/outfit in check, and can be used all day when you have a limited schedule. Studio portraits are limited to the looks we have available, and we can fit about 15 people max.

    Outdoor sessions offer seasonal beauty, organic movement, and unlimited amount of people. However, we are limited to the time of day certain settings will photograph well, and there can be wind and temperature elements. Also consider walking to the location, parking, and imperfect hair/makeup/outfit.

  • Milestone portraits are baby’s first year, birthdays, graduations, anniversaries, etc.

    Milestones are generally best shot in the studio, or as a hybrid studio/outdoor session. Since the studio is a controlled environment, so it lends itself to birthday cakes, outfits like maternity gowns and graduation garb, balloons, confetti, signs, and themed props.
